Comparing the Primary Materials for Durable Entry Doors

Steel Entry Doors

Steel entry doors are widely recognized for delivering superior physical strength and high-level structural security. Constructed with an inner structural frame, a dense insulating core, and outer heavy-gauge steel skin, these doors offer maximum resistance against forced entry and severe wind damage.

  • Pros: Highly affordable upfront cost, exceptional security, and complete resistance to warping or swelling caused by humidity.
  • Cons: Susceptible to surface denting from sharp impacts and potential rusting if protective paint or factory coatings are scratched or left unmaintained. Conducts temperature easily unless built with a thermal break and a solid polyurethane foam core.

Fiberglass Entry Doors

Fiberglass entry doors represent one of the most versatile and durable options on the market today. Engineered with composite skins surrounding a rigid polyurethane foam core, fiberglass does not rot, rust, corrode, or warp—making it exceptionally suited for moist or wet environments.

  • Pros: Impervious to moisture damage, highly scratch-resistant, virtually maintenance-free, and exceptionally energy efficient. Advanced manufacturing allows fiberglass to convincingly replicate authentic natural wood grain patterns.
  • Cons: Higher initial purchasing cost compared to standard steel doors, and low-quality models may crack under extreme, high-impact force.

Solid Wood Entry Doors

Traditional solid wood doors remain a benchmark for architectural elegance, prestige, and timeless beauty. Crafted from dense hardwoods like mahogany, oak, cherry, or engineered wood cores with real-wood veneers, wood provides high natural insulation and exceptional acoustic dampening.

  • Pros: Unmatched natural aesthetic appeal, easily customizable with unique stains or carvings, and simple to repair if surface scratches occur.
  • Cons: Requires significant ongoing maintenance, including routine sanding, staining, and re-sealing to prevent moisture absorption, warping, swelling, and rot. Premium wood doors carry the highest upfront price tag.

Climate Considerations for Doors in Derry, NH

The variable New England climate presents significant challenges to exterior building materials. Derry, NH experiences harsh, freezing winters with heavy snowfall, followed by hot, humid summer months.

When selecting an entry door material for this local environment:

  • Moisture and Freeze-Thaw Resistance: Repeated freezing and thawing can force trapped moisture inside organic door materials to expand, causing natural wood doors to split, warp, or stick in their frames. Fully synthetic fiberglass composite doors eliminate moisture absorption, preventing frame alignment issues throughout seasonal shifts.
  • Thermal Expansion: Metallic materials like steel expand and contract significantly during extreme temperature shifts, which can strain door hinges and weatherstripping over time. Utilizing composite threshold systems and thermal breaks prevents cold transfer into the home.

Maximizing Energy Efficiency and Thermal Performance

An entry door’s material composition directly dictates its ability to prevent draftiness and lower residential heating or cooling costs:

  • Insulated Cores: High-performance steel and fiberglass doors feature dense polyurethane foam cores that provide up to five times the insulating value of solid wood doors.
  • ENERGY STAR® Certification: Selecting an ENERGY STAR® certified door system ensures the assembly—including the door slab, glass inserts, frame, and weatherstripping—meets strict federal energy efficiency benchmarks designed to minimize thermal transfer.
  • Weatherstripping and Threshold Sealing: Even the most durable material will fail if air leaks occur around the perimeter. Look for doors equipped with heavy-duty adjustable thresholds, magnetic weatherstripping, and bottom sweeps to form an airtight seal against freezing winter winds.

Balancing Architectural Aesthetics and Structural Integrity

Modern door manufacturing allows homeowners to achieve sophisticated architectural styling without compromising long-term material performance:

  • Factory Finishes: Pre-finished fiberglass and steel doors feature multi-layer factory coatings that offer far superior UV and moisture protection compared to field-applied paints or stains.
  • Decorative Glass Inserts: Incorporating double- or triple-pane insulated glass with Low-E coatings allows natural light into the entryway while maintaining the overall thermal integrity and impact resistance of the door slab.
  • Customization: High-end fiberglass doors offer realistic wood grain textures—such as oak, mahogany, or fir—that accept natural stain colors while providing the superior durability and maintenance-free benefits of synthetic composites.
